Master Looter Posts: 2325 Joined: 13 May 2005 | Bishop, an underplayed and underrated class. but still the most fun to me. DDs are just to easy keep me interested for a long time. point, click and wait who dies first isnt half as fun, as constantly by on the lookout for agro, checking hp bars of 9 players and looking if an enemy is approaching to get ready for heals, running around and surviving.
